Artemis II NASA Mission Patch - astronomy cross stitch pattern

Regular price £6.00 £0.00 Unit price per

Celebrate the successful launch of the Artemis II mission to fly humans further into space than ever before! This pattern of the Artemis II Mission Patch includes a detailed booklet all about the Artemis series of missions. The pattern was previously released as part of the Climbing Goat Club, and is now available for general release.

Other Artemis themed patterns are also available.

• Stitch count: 90 wide x 94 high
• Approximate size on 14 count aida: 6.4in wide x 6.7in high (16.3cm wide x 17.1cm high)
• 9 colours, DMC numbers given
• Uses full cross stitches, backstitch and fractional stitches
• Stitch on dark fabric (model is stitched on black fabric); or stitch on pale fabric by filling in the gaps within the triangle with black cross stitches
• Suitable for those with a little experience of cross stitch
